zlib is now required
[swftools.git] / configure.in
index 47fac70..27b4b6c 100644 (file)
@@ -21,7 +21,7 @@ AC_ARG_ENABLE(lame,
 [  --disable-lame          don't compile any L.A.M.E. mp3 encoding code in], DISABLE_LAME=true)
 
 PACKAGE=swftools
-VERSION=2006-12-02-1537
+VERSION=2007-01-13-1826
 
 
 # ------------------------------------------------------------------
@@ -31,9 +31,9 @@ if test "x${srcdir}" != "x."; then
     exit 1
 fi
 
-WARNINGS="-Wparentheses -Wimplicit -Wreturn-type"
+WARNINGS="-Wparentheses -Wimplicit -Wreturn-type -Wno-unused-value"
 if test "x$ENABLE_WARNINGS" '!=' "x";then
-    WARNINGS="-Wall -Wno-unused -Wno-format -Wno-redundant-decls"
+    WARNINGS="-Wall -Wno-unused -Wno-format -Wno-redundant-decls -D_FORTIFY_SOURCE=2 "
 fi
 
 if test "x$CHECKMEM" '!=' "x";then
@@ -44,8 +44,9 @@ if test "x$PROFILING" '!=' "x";then
 fi
 if test "x$DEBUG" '!=' "x";then
     if test "x$PROFILING" = "x";then
-        CFLAGS="$WARNINGS -O2 -g -D_FORTIFY_SOURCE=2 $CFLAGS"
-        CXXFLAGS="$WARNINGS -O2 -g -D_FORTIFY_SOURCE=2 $CXXFLAGS"
+        CFLAGS="$WARNINGS -O2 -g $CFLAGS"
+        CXXFLAGS="$WARNINGS -O2 -g $CXXFLAGS"
+        LDFLAGS="-g $LIBS"
     else
         CFLAGS="$WARNINGS -O2 -g -pg $CFLAGS"
         CXXFLAGS="$WARNINGS -O2 -g -pg $CXXFLAGS"
@@ -185,7 +186,7 @@ fi
 
 
 # this must be done after (I believe) AC_PROG_MAKE_SET
-if test "x$DEBUG" '!=' "x";then
+if test "x$DEBUG" '!=' "x" -o "x$STRIP" = "x";then
     STRIP="@echo debug enabled, not stripping "
     export STRIP
     AC_SUBST(STRIP)
@@ -197,9 +198,22 @@ dnl Checks for libraries.
  exit;
  )
  AC_CHECK_LIB(z, deflate,, ZLIBMISSING=true)
- AC_CHECK_LIB(jpeg, jpeg_write_raw_data,, JPEGLIBMISSING=true)
- AC_CHECK_LIB(t1, T1_LoadFont,, T1LIBMISSING=true)
- AC_CHECK_LIB(ungif, DGifOpen,, UNGIFMISSING=true)
+
+if test "x$ZLIBMISSING" = "xtrue";then
+    echo 
+    echo "ERROR:"
+    echo "You need zlib to compile swftools"
+    echo
+    exit
+fi
+AC_CHECK_LIB(jpeg, jpeg_write_raw_data,, JPEGLIBMISSING=true)
+AC_CHECK_LIB(t1, T1_LoadFont,, T1LIBMISSING=true)
+AC_CHECK_LIB(ungif, DGifOpen,, UNGIFMISSING=true)
+if "$UNGIFMISSING";then
+    UNGIFMISSING=
+    AC_CHECK_LIB(gif, DGifOpen,, UNGIFMISSING=true)
+fi
 
 RFX_CHECK_BYTEORDER
 AC_SUBST(WORDS_BIGENDIAN)